Kirjoittaja Aihe: Compiz ja ikkunalistat  (Luettu 1660 kertaa)

ippanis

  • Käyttäjä
  • Viestejä: 73
    • Profiili
Compiz ja ikkunalistat
« : 25.08.08 - klo:12.17 »
Noniin

Nyt on ikkunalistojen (eli windowborder) kanssa ongelmia. Ongelmia on lähinnä tuon firefoxin kanssa, se ei näytä listoja ollenkaan. Osa ohjelmista näyttää sen ongelmitta, osa taas aukeaa esim. yläpaneelin taakse niin, ettei pääse ikkunalistaan käsiksi.
Saan kyllä muutettua firefoxia pienemmäksi, mutta esim tämä firefox ei tajua noita paneeleita (2 kpl, toinen ylhäällä ja toinen alhaalla), että ne ovat lukitut vaan se menee noiden paneelien alle, jolloin kaikki valinta on vaikeeta. Välillä käy niin että molemmat paneelit katoaa ja joudun sulkemaan firefoxin tiedosto -> sulje, jolloin paneelit taas näkyvät.

Olen nyt laittanut xorg.conf ADDARGBVisuals "True" Device osioon, mutta toistaikseksi ei löydy pelastusta. Olen myös googlannyt ja koittanut muiden ohjeilla.

Kaikki toimii sitten hyvin jos vaihdan teeman metacityyn, mutta sitten lähtee kaikki efektitkin...

tuossa on mun xorg.conf at the moment:
Koodia: [Valitse]
#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ig:  version 1.0  (buildmeister@builder3)  Thu Feb 14 18:20:37 PST 2008

# nvidia-settings: X configuration file generated by nvidia-settings
# nvidia-settings:  version 1.0  (buildd@vernadsky)  Thu Jun  5 09:26:53 UTC 2008
# xorg.conf (X.Org X Window System server configuration file)
#
# This file was generated by dexconf, the Debian X Configuration tool, using
# values from the debconf database.
#
# Edit this file with caution, and see the xorg.conf manual page.
# (Type "man xorg.conf" at the shell prompt.)
#
# This file is automatically updated on xserver-xorg package upgrades *only*
# if it has not been modified since the last upgrade of the xserver-xorg
# package.
#
# If you have edited this file but would like it to be automatically updated
# again, run the following command:
#   sudo dpkg-reconfigure -phigh xserver-xorg

Section "ServerLayout"
    Identifier     "Default Layout"
    Screen      0  "Screen0" 0 0
    InputDevice    "Generic Keyboard" "CoreKeyboard"
    InputDevice    "Configured Mouse"
    InputDevice    "Synaptics Touchpad"
EndSection

Section "Module"
    Load           "glx"
EndSection

Section "ServerFlags"
    Option         "Xinerama" "0"
EndSection

Section "InputDevice"
    Identifier     "Generic Keyboard"
    Driver         "kbd"
    Option         "XkbRules" "xorg"
    Option         "XkbModel" "pc105"
    Option         "XkbLayout" "us"
EndSection

Section "InputDevice"
    Identifier     "Configured Mouse"
    Driver         "mouse"
    Option         "CorePointer"
    Option         "Emulate3Buttons" "true"
EndSection

Section "InputDevice"
    Identifier     "Synaptics Touchpad"
    Driver         "synaptics"
    Option         "SendCoreEvents" "true"
    Option         "Device" "/dev/psaux"
    Option         "Protocol" "auto-dev"
    Option         "HorizEdgeScroll" "0"
EndSection

Section "Monitor"
    Identifier     "Configured Monitor"
EndSection

Section "Monitor"
    Identifier     "Monitor0"
    VendorName     "Unknown"
    ModelName      "CRT-0"
    HorizSync       30.0 - 75.0
    VertRefresh     60.0
EndSection

Section "Device"
    Identifier     "Configured Video Device"
    Driver         "nvidia"
    Option         "NoLogo" "True"
    Option    "AddARGBVisuals" "True"
    Option    "AddARGBGLXVisuals" "True"
EndSection

Section "Device"
    Identifier      "Videocard0"
    Driver          "nvidia"
    VendorName      "NVIDIA Corporation"
    BoardName      "GeForce Go 7200"
EndSection

Section "Screen"
    Identifier     "Default Screen"
    Device         "Configured Video Device"
    Monitor        "Configured Monitor"
    DefaultDepth    24
EndSection

Section "Screen"
    Identifier     "Screen0"
    Device         "Videocard0"
    Monitor        "Monitor0"
    DefaultDepth    24
    Option         "TwinView" "1"
    Option         "TwinViewXineramaInfoOrder" "DFP-0"
    Option         "metamodes" "CRT: 1024x768 +128+16, DFP: 1280x800 +0+0"
    SubSection     "Display"
        Depth       24
        Modes      "nvidia-auto-select"
    EndSubSection
EndSection

Jostain sain sen verran kaivettua, että xgl (?) ei ole päällä kun compiz on toiminnassa.

Koodia: [Valitse]
miikka@HPdv6158eu:~$ compiz --replace
Checking for Xgl: not present.
Detected PCI ID for VGA: 05:00.0 0300: 10de:01d6 (rev a1) (prog-if 00 [VGA controller])
Checking for texture_from_pixmap: present.
Checking for non power of two support: present.
Checking for Composite extension: present.
Comparing resolution (1280x800) to maximum 3D texture size (4096): Passed.
Checking for nVidia: present.
Checking for FBConfig: present.
Checking for Xgl: not present.
/usr/bin/compiz.real (video) - Warn: No 8 bit GLX pixmap format, disabling YV12 image format

PS. just kun tuon kirjoitin päätteeseen niin kone vaan välkkuu ja vähän sekoili...



« Viimeksi muokattu: 25.08.08 - klo:12.19 kirjoittanut ippanis »
EI ubuntun voittanutta

harrykaa

  • Vieras
Vs: Compiz ja ikkunalistat
« Vastaus #1 : 25.08.08 - klo:13.50 »
Tämä ikkunoiden yläpalkin katoaminen johtuu varsin usein siitä, että näytönohjain (monesti jokin vanha ATI, kuten Radeon 9600) ei pysty käsittelemään samanaikaisesti selaimen flash-toimintoa ja Compizia taikka pelkästään Compizia. Linux voi joskus suoraan käynnistyä tällaiseen tilaan. Osasyynä voi olla ajurinkin heikkous.
Tällöin voi hiiren kakkospainikkeella klikata työpöytää ja kohdasta "change background" valita välilehti "visual effects" ja ottaa tehosteet pois käytöstä.
Sen jälkeen siis Compiz ei ole päällä, mutta ikkunoiden yläpalkit ovat, eikä jumittumisiakaan enää tapahdu (ks. alla).

Ongelma voi ilmetä myös niin, että selain (esim. FF) jumittaa koko näytön, niin ettei hiiren kursorikaan toimi.
Tällöin on parasta pelastautua näppäinyhdistelmällä:
Alt + Print Screen + R, E, I, S, U, B (aluksi alt, sitten print screen, molemmat painettuna jokainen kirjain r e i s u b vuoron perään alas) ja kone käynnistyy uudestaan.

harrykaa